Do I need to have or buy certain kit before working with you?

As long as you have comfortable, practical swimwear, a pair of goggles and a swim cap (if needed to keep hair out of your eyes), you're all good to go. However, different types of kit can be very beneficial in learning to swim through practicing different drills. Therefore, I advise having a kit bag that includes a kickboard and pull buoy as a minimum, but ideally also hand paddles, fins and a snorkel. What kind of swimming abilities can you work with?

As a baseline level to fully benefit from online coaching, you need to be able to swim at least a full 50m of front crawl (freestyle) comfortably unaided, without stopping or putting your feet down, and can swim at least 400m during a training session. If you aren't quite at that level yet I would advise having some in-person coaching first, which would be more beneficial at this stage. At the other end of the spectrum, I am happy to work with confident, competent swimmers looking to improve their personal best times or just need small technique adjustments.

Where/how can I get footage of myself swimming?

You don't need any fancy filming equipment; phone footage taken by a friend/family works perfectly. Make sure to check with your local pool for permission before filming. If your local pool doesn't allow it, try calling around other nearby pools/lidos as they often have different regulations. You can also ask if there are particular quiet or adult only swim times that might work better, and explain it will only take 5-10 minutes. Other options include obtaining footage in open water settings, private pools or booking out a swimming lane for a small fee.
